I have a 2012 non-airmatic cabrio and was wondering what the sport mode actually does. Does it change the shift points in the transmission? Does it affect the suspension in anyway? I am looking for options for lowering the car.

On the 2012 E550cab, which I have, sport mode changes both transmission shift points and stiffens the suspension. On the E350, I believe the suspension does not change, only the trans.

According to the sales brochure for the 2012 e class Cabrio and coupe the sport setting changes the dampening rates of the shocks, the throttle response and transmission shift points. I own a 2012 550 Cabrio and I feel a significant seat of the pants difference in the sport mode, but the suspension remains at the same height.
